The detection of neutrinos by Reines and Cowan in 1956, the demonstration of neutrino oscillations recognized by the 2015 Nobel Prize in Physics, and the 2017 confirmation of coherent elastic neutrino–nucleus scattering (CEνNS) by the COHERENT experiment all laid the groundwork.
